EACOP Management Team and Regulators Visit State-of-the-Art Thermal Insulation System (TIS) Coating Plant

On October 10, 2024, a delegation of regulators from the Petroleum Authority of Uganda (PAU) and the Energy and Water Utilities Regulatory Authority (EWURA) in Tanzania, accompanied by the EACOP Management Team, visited the Thermal Insulation System (TIS) Coating Plant located in Sojo. EAST AFRICAN CRUDE OIL PIPELINE (EACOP) Ltd. LAUNCHES THE EACOP ACADEMY IN TANZANIA

The East African Crude Oil Pipeline (EACOP) project is proud to announce the official inauguration of the EACOP Academy on 18th September 2024 at Mt. Meru Hotel in Arusha City. CPP and EACOP Launch Welding Training Program for Local Trainees!

China Petroleum Pipeline Engineering Co. Ltd (CPP), the key Feeder Line and above ground installation Contractor for the East African Crude Oil Pipeline (EACOP) Project, initiated a comprehensive training program that aims to enhance and impart skills to local trainees for the betterment of pipeline construction. Strengthening Collaborations: EACOP Quarterly Meetings with NGOs

In an effort to strengthen collaboration and transparency, the East African Crude Oil Pipeline (EACOP) holds quarterly meetings both in Dar es Salaam and online, inviting Non-Governmental Organizations (NGOs) from across Tanzania to participate. EACOP SIGNS FPIC AGREEMENT WITH THE BARABAIG COMMUNITY OF GORIMBA VILLAGE, HANANG DISTRICT, EMPHASIZING COMMITMENT TO INDIGENOUS PEOPLES.

In a significant development highlighting its commitment to human rights, cultural preservation, and responsible project implementation, the East African Crude Oil Pipeline (EACOP) proudly announces the signing of a Free, Prior, and Informed Consent (FPIC) Agreement with the Barabaig community of Gorimba Village in Hanang district.
